General annotation (Comments)

Function

May conjugate Arg from its aminoacyl-tRNA to the N-termini of proteins containing an N-terminal aspartate or glutamate Potential. HAMAP MF_00689

Catalytic activity

L-arginyl-tRNA + protein = tRNA + L-arginyl-protein. HAMAP MF_00689

Subcellular location

Cytoplasm Potential HAMAP MF_00689.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the R-transferase family.
